Transaction 2d24bb66310345dab3151b7702d00b278eff9812f6d1db8a67441b8b01b07879

64 Input
2 Outputs
  • 2d24bb66310345dab3151b7702d00b278eff9812f6d1db8a67441b8b01b07879:0
  • value  6007271672
    address  1K58BnNNUGXdwTM5Fxekt22pUACTDs2XJE
  • 2d24bb66310345dab3151b7702d00b278eff9812f6d1db8a67441b8b01b07879:1
  • value  1000027
    address  16vk7gsW8CECWzxKNT3FLnqaB6paKeiQY5